Order statuses

WooCommerce → Orders lists Pending payment, Processing, Completed, Cancelled, Refunded, Failed.

Define internally when to mark Processing (payment captured) vs Completed (shipped).

Email notifications

WooCommerce → Settings → Emails: enable new order (admin), completed order (customer), and customize sender name.

Send test emails; if they fail, fix SMTP — customers assume silence means fraud.

Processing refunds

Refunds from Orders → Edit → Refund via API when the gateway supports it; otherwise manual refund plus order note.

Always leave an order note for support history.

Reports and exports

WooCommerce → Analytics (or Reports) for revenue, top products, and coupons.

Export CSV for accounting on schedule, not only at tax deadline.

Security and roles

Give staff Shop manager role, not Administrator, when possible.

Disable file editing in production; audit plugins quarterly.
